Unical to graduate 7, 769 students in her 35th convocation

By Ene Asuquo

The authority of the University of Calabar has said that a total of seven thousand seven hundred and sixtynine (7,769) students of the institution will be graduating in her 35th convocation schedule for Saturday 6th of May 2023

Making the disclosure recently during a press briefing in calabar to mark the commencement of the 35th convocation of the University  at the Senate Chambers,  the vice chancellor, prof. Florence Banku Obi said that 11students have first class, 899 students have second class upper while 271 have second class lower 

She also disclosed that 721 students have third class while 519 PhD students will also be convocated 

The vice chancellor also told journalists that as part of the activities to mark the events, there will be a research fare and exhibition first ever organized by the institution which will be sponsored by Fidelity Bank PLC, and that prices and award would be  given to faculties and best researchers 

It was also reveal that there will be an investiture of Alhaji Aminu Ado Bayero, the Emir of Kano as the chancellor of the University of Calabar and that there would also be a convocation lecture by the chief of staff to the president, prof. Ibrahim Gambari 

Prof. Obi also made it known to the press that former president, Good luck Ebele Jonathan would be  given a Honourary Degree alone with two other people, chief Executive officer of Northwest petroleum and Gas, Mrs.Winnifred Akpani and a business tycoon, Tola Johnson

The University also disclosed that the award of first degrees, masters and diploma would be on the 5th of May 2023, while setting aside another date, 6th of May 2023 for the award of Doctorate degrees
